NCT Number: NCT02672644
Study is designed to characterize subject and treating investigator reported outcomes in the early post-treatment period, following bilateral correction of nasolabial folds using Emervel Classic and Emervel Deep.
1. to evaluate subject-reported return to social engagement, after the initial treatment (Baseline/Day 1 visit). 2. to evaluate change in Global Aesthetic Improvement Scale (GAIS) at day 30- subject/investigator reported 3. to evaluate subject satisfaction with treatment outcome at baseline, day 14 and day 30. 4. to evaluate change in Wrinkle Severity Rating Scale (WSRS) from baseline to post-treatment follow-up time points at day 14 and Day 30 - investigator reported 5. to evaluate all adverse events during the course of the study
